Bridge Investment Group Holdings Inc. (NYSE:BRDG – Get Free Report)’s share price gapped up before the market opened on Monday after the company announced better than expected quarterly earnings. The stock had previously closed at $7.92, but opened at $10.56. Bridge Investment Group shares last traded at $10.63, with a volume of 978,802 shares traded.
The company reported $0.18 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.16 by $0.02. Bridge Investment Group had a return on equity of 9.91% and a net margin of 1.92%.

Bridge Investment Group Company Profile
Bridge Investment Group Holdings Inc engages in the real estate investment management business in the United States. It manages capital on behalf of approximately hundred global institutions and 6,500 individual investors across approximately 25 investment vehicles. The company was founded in 2009 and is headquartered in Salt Lake City, Utah.
